A new error resilience scheme based on FMO and error concealment in H.264/AVC

Slice group coding using Flexible Macroblock Ordering (FMO) based on Macroblock (MB) importance in H.264/AVC has been studied for providing higher error robustness in error prone environments. However, the efficiency still needs to be improved and the high computational and time cost it causes remains to be an issue. In this paper, an Adaptive Macroblock-to-slice Allocation map (MBAmap) Updating scheme is proposed based on our previous research work. The extra computational and time cost introduced is less than 10% compared to the conventional methods. The PSNR of the reconstructed video at the decoder side can be improved for up to 0.6dB compared to previous proposed method. A Slice Matching (SM) error concealment method is also introduced, which increases the PSNR for a further 0.2 to 0.4dB when applied with the slice group coding scheme.

[1]  E. O. Elliott Estimates of error rates for codes on burst-noise channels , 1963 .

[2]  Ajay Luthra,et al.  Overview of the H.264/AVC video coding standard , 2003, IEEE Trans. Circuits Syst. Video Technol..

[3]  Baoxin Li,et al.  An enhanced rate control scheme with motion assisted slice grouping for low bit rate coding in H.264 , 2008, 2008 15th IEEE International Conference on Image Processing.

[4]  Supavadee Aramvith,et al.  An error resilience technique based on FMO and error propagation for H.264 video coding in error-prone channels , 2009, 2009 IEEE International Conference on Multimedia and Expo.

[5]  Miska M. Hannuksela,et al.  The error concealment feature in the H.26L test model , 2002, Proceedings. International Conference on Image Processing.

[6]  Ajay Luthra,et al.  Overview of the H.264/AVC video coding standard , 2003, SPIE Optics + Photonics.

[7]  Byeungwoo Jeon,et al.  Fast Coding Mode Selection With Rate-Distortion Optimization for MPEG-4 Part-10 AVC/H.264 , 2006, IEEE Transactions on Circuits and Systems for Video Technology.

[8]  Alan Pearmain,et al.  An improved FMO slice grouping method for error resilience in H.264/AVC , 2010, 2010 IEEE International Conference on Acoustics, Speech and Signal Processing.

[9]  Alan Pearmain,et al.  Error resilient video coding with priority data classification using H.264 flexible macroblock ordering , 2007 .

[10]  Gary J. Sullivan,et al.  Rate-constrained coder control and comparison of video coding standards , 2003, IEEE Trans. Circuits Syst. Video Technol..

[11]  Wen-Jiin Tsai,et al.  A new unequal error protection scheme based on FMO , 2008, 2008 15th IEEE International Conference on Image Processing.